Output 6621c214098bc4618bff562c36b88d49fe77c80265ce130b52221943a7aa3852:113

value
179415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e1245e582e6659223c25411639a7ecc53ae8602 OP_EQUAL
address
3Bj29H4UmQh89cH6ghYGFfKf9AEbyMqiZF
transaction
6621c214098bc4618bff562c36b88d49fe77c80265ce130b52221943a7aa3852
spent
true